PIPPIN
Little Pippin needs a home. She is not quite a Golden and is much smaller but has had a dreadful life and has never been out for a walk ever. Worried about the outdoors but we are winning with a harness as the only time she had anything round her neck was when she was taken away on one of those loop things that dog catchers use. so freaks if a collar is put on She is coming round and needs an understanding home. She is used to other dogs.
